Output 2985ef028c1fae61a19d062fc9c5b245d90b601f8d9a6067be1d325dc77cb4e2:0

value
668853
script pubkey
OP_0 OP_PUSHBYTES_20 4dd7b650e4fdc989a1801c4f9f0399f0fe07d5f1
address
bc1qfhtmv58ylhycngvqr38e7que7rlq0403p3037w
transaction
2985ef028c1fae61a19d062fc9c5b245d90b601f8d9a6067be1d325dc77cb4e2
spent
true